Need some academic assistance?The Student Center for Academic Achievement is an invaluable resource to CSUEB students. Located in the campus library, SCAA provides students with tutoring in a host of subjects, as well as offering employment opportunities for students interested in becoming a SCAA tutor.

Want some help finding a job?Academic Advising and Career Education (AACE) is a one-stop center for both academic advising and career development assistance. Our counselors guide students in understanding and completing all General Education and graduation requirements in addition to helping them clarify and attain their career goals. AACE is also home to PACE (Program for Accelerated College Education) advising and is happy to open its doors to all eligible East Bay students and qualified alumni.
AACE offers job-searching assistance for applicants of all levels, and much more. |
